Huh, I wonder if that is even supported …

The FeatureID check is done different by WFS, and does not always integrate well with functions and so on. There is a configuration option to both use primary keys to generate FeatureID and also make available as an attribute for use with functions.

Are you comfortable trying the same request with an XML query? …to see if it is a problem with the data store, or if it is a problem with CQL constructing a query …

Reading
https://docs.geoserver.org/main/en/user/filter/ecql_reference.html you may wish to try:

in('R403139')

Assuming R403139 is a feature identifier.

    i'm trying to use a cql_filter on a feature but something is strange.

    cql_filter:  "id = 'R403139'" is working fine. i'll get only this
    feature.

    but           "id in('R403139')" does not give any result (without
    error messages).

    i need a list, because later on there more features will be
    dynanical selected. e.g. "id in('R403139', 'R1719140')"

    What am i doing wrong?
